A simple new method of practical use was described for the demonstration of spiral structure of meiotic chromosomes in the PMC. It simply consists in that usual drinking or distilled water is used for pretreatment. A smear of PMCs is made on a slide, and a very small amount of water is added on it, which is left for a short time. The smear is then fixed and stained with acetocarmine. This method is likewise applicable to permanent smears with fair result.
